                   A  BILL  FOR  AN  ACT

RELATING TO UNCLAIMED PROPERTY.
 


B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F HAWAII:

 1      SECTION 1.  Chapter 523A, Hawaii Revised Statutes, is
 
 2 amended by adding a new section to be appropriate designated and
 
 3 to read as follows:
 
 4      "§523A-    Unclaimed property trust fund.  (a)  There is
 
 5 established in the state treasury the unclaimed property trust
 
 6 fund, which shall be administered by the director.
 
 7      (b)  The proceeds of the fund shall be used to pay claims
 
 8 for return of abandoned property to their rightful owners and to
 
 9 other states' unclaimed property programs for owners whose last
 
10 known address was in that other state.
 
11      (c)  All moneys collected by the unclaimed property program
 
12 from holders, and proceeds from the sale of unclaimed property
 
13 less costs in connection with the sale of the abandoned property
 
14 shall be deposited into the unclaimed property trust fund.
 
15      (d)  All funds in the unclaimed property trust fund in
 
16 excess of $1,000,000 remaining on balance on June 30 of each year
 
17 shall lapse to the credit of the general fund."
 
18      SECTION 2.  Section 523A-23, Hawaii Revised Statutes, is
 
19 amended to read as follows:

 1      "[[]§523A-23[]]  Deposit of funds.(a)  Except as otherwise
 
 2 provided by this section, the director shall promptly deposit in
 
 3 the [general] unclaimed property trust fund of this State all
 
 4 funds received under this part, including the proceeds from the
 
 5 sale of abandoned property under section 523A-22.  All funds in
 
 6 excess of $1,000,000 remaining on balance in the unclaimed
 
 7 property trust fund on June 30 of each year shall be transferred
 
 8 by the director to the general fund.  The trust fund balance
 
 9 shall be invested by the director and all such investment
 
10 earnings shall be deposited to the credit of the general fund.
 
11      (b)  Before making any deposit to the credit of the
 
12 [general] unclaimed property trust fund, the director may deduct:
 
13      (1)  Any costs in connection with the sale of abandoned
 
14           property;
 
15      (2)  Costs of mailing and publication in connection with any
 
16           abandoned property;
 
17      (3)  Reasonable service charges; and
 
18      (4)  Costs incurred in examining records of holders of
 
19           property and in collecting the property from those
 
20           holders."
 
21      SECTION 3.  Section 523A-24, Hawaii Revised Statutes, is
 
22 amended by amending subsection (c) to read as follows:
 
23      "(c)  If a claim is allowed, the director shall pay [over]

 1 via a check from the unclaimed property trust fund or deliver to
 
 2 the claimant the property or the amount the director actually
 
 3 received or the net proceeds if it has been sold by the director,
 
 4 together with any additional amount required by section 523A-21.
 
 5 If the claim is for property presumed abandoned under section
 
 6 523A-10 which was sold by the director within three years after
 
 7 the date of delivery, the amount payable for that claim is the
 
 8 value of the property at the time the claim was made or the net
 
 9 proceeds of sale, whichever is greater."
 
10      SECTION 4.  There is appropriated out of the general
 
11 revenues of the State of Hawaii the sum of $500,000, or so much
 
12 thereof as may be necessary for fiscal year 2000-2001, to be
 
13 deposited into the unclaimed property trust fund, for the purpose
 
14 of satisfying claims for return of abandoned property.
 
15      SECTION 5.  The sum appropriated shall be expended by the
 
16 department of budget and finance for the purposes of this Act.
 
17      SECTION 6.  Statutory material to be repealed is bracketed.
 
18 New statutory material is underscored.
 
19      SECTION 7.  This Act shall take effect upon its approval.
